SafePal has reported a security incident involving unauthorized access to customer order information, affecting approximately 39,798 users who placed orders between March 2, 2025, and April 11, 2026. The breach was due to an authorization flaw in an order-tracking plugin, allowing unauthorized access to names, email addresses, shipping addresses, phone numbers, and purchase details. Importantly, the incident did not compromise any wallet security data, such as seed phrases or private keys. SafePal has patched the vulnerability and implemented additional security measures. Affected customers have been notified via email and can verify their status on SafePal's website. The incident raises concerns about potential phishing and impersonation attempts targeting affected users. SafePal has removed over 30 fraudulent websites linked to the breach and is urging customers to remain vigilant against scams.
